And hee came to Nazareth where hee had bene brought vp, and (as his custome was) went into the Synagogue on the Sabbath day, and stoode vp to reade.
And there was deliuered vnto him the booke of the Prophet Esaias: and when hee had opened the booke, hee founde the place, where it was written,
The Spirit of the Lord is vpon mee, because he hath anoynted me, that I should preach the Gospel to the poore: he hath sent mee, that I should heale the broken hearted, that I should preach deliuerance to the captiues, and recouering of sight to the blinde, that I should set at libertie them that are bruised:
And that I should preache the acceptable yeere of the Lord.
And hee closed the booke, and gaue it againe to the minister, and sate downe: and the eyes of all that were in the Synagogue were fastened on him.
Then he began to say vnto them, This day is the Scripture fulfilled in your eares.

For the Iewes Passeouer was at hande. Therefore Iesus went vp to Hierusalem.
And he found in the Temple those that sold oxen, and sheepe, and doues, and changers of money, sitting there.
Then hee made a scourge of small cordes, and draue them all out of the Temple with the sheepe and oxen, and powred out the changers money, and ouerthrewe the tables,
And said vnto them that solde doues, Take these things hence: make not my fathers house, an house of marchandise.
And his disciples remembred, that it was written, The zeale of thine house hath eaten me vp.
